The indictment charges HARRIS, HORTON, and STANLEY with one count of conspiracy to commit securities fraud and one count of securities fraud each.

HARRIS is also charged with one count of providing a false certification of a financial statement.

The securities fraud charges carry a maximum sentence of 25 years in prison and a fine of up to $250,000.

The false certification of a financial statement charge carries a maximum sentence of 10 years in prison and a fine of up to $1,000,000.

In determining the actual sentence, the Court will consider the United States Sentencing Guidelines, which are not binding but provide appropriate sentencing ranges for most offenders.
